Northwest Logic Announces Complete PCI Express 2.0 Solution For Xilinx Virtex-5FXT Devices

Solution Provides a High-Performance, Hardware-Proven PCI Express 2.0 and DDR3 SDRAM Development Platform

BEAVERTON, Ore.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Northwest Logic today announced the immediate availability of a high-performance, hardware-proven PCI Express® 2.0 solution for Xilinx’s Virtex®-5 FXT platform. This solution combines Northwest Logic’s full-featured PCI Express 2.0 Core (5Gbit/s), a high-performance, on-demand, multi-engine DMA Back-End Core, DMA Driver (Windows or Linux) and PCI Express GUI to provide a complete, pre-packaged PCI Express 2.0 solution. The solution enables high-performance, multi-DMA engine PCI Express 2.0 designs to be quickly developed for the Virtex-5FXT FPGAs.

Northwest Logic’s PCI Express Solution optionally includes high-performance DDR3/DDR2/DDR SDRAM Controller Cores. These cores are part of Northwest Logic’s Memory Interface Solution, which also includes AHB/AXI Interface, Multi-Port, Reorder, RMW, ECC, and Memory Test add-on cores. Northwest Logic’s PCI Express 2.0 Solution is fully hardware validated using HiTech Global’s HTG-V5-PCIE-DDR3 board. This card is ideal as a PCI Express 2.0/DDR3 SDRAM Virtex-5FXT FPGA development and ASIC prototyping platform. “We are pleased to be the first provider of a hardware-proven solution using Xilinx’s Virtex-5FXT device and Northwest Logic’s complete PCI Express 2.0 and DDR3 SDRAM IP cores,” said Cyrus Merati, Vice President of HiTech Global.
